Transaction 5656ed787eb8d4b4a7635a8259429c590b9900c9af70ce7be36a19d93464ee93

1 Input
2 Outputs
  • 5656ed787eb8d4b4a7635a8259429c590b9900c9af70ce7be36a19d93464ee93:0
  • value  145540
    address  13ha54MW2hYUS3q1jJhFyWdpNfdfMWtmhZ
  • 5656ed787eb8d4b4a7635a8259429c590b9900c9af70ce7be36a19d93464ee93:1
  • value  2423
    address  1PqGwmarMSVV23Nqfs97ob3N2n2AdaDNbE